Output 566bb32cb23bf92efd86e28311deecb2e5bf14873da45180bcf61629af926630:30

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3e3e5205db1b5a3eef29c880af1f641244c6d9 OP_EQUAL
address
3PW1z99DFdpeA5zjwDMr9KUtS4mYZefgkf
transaction
566bb32cb23bf92efd86e28311deecb2e5bf14873da45180bcf61629af926630
spent
true